A340-300 Market Presence. The A340-300 has previously provided operators with considerable operating flexibility. The four-engine configuration, combined with long haul capability, opened up a number of routes unable to support either the larger B777-300ER or the ETOPs constrained twin engined B777-200ER. Demand for B767-300ER Holds Steady Despite Collapse of Zoom
The demand for the B767-300ER remains sufficiently strong to cope with the collapse of Zoom, a prominent operator of the type. Pricing of New Narrowbody Aircraft Remains Competitive
Despite the best efforts of the manufacturers to raise pricing of new aircraft, apart from the benefit of escalation of base prices, the net cost of new narrowbody aircraft has remained virtually static.
